Output d5ca880bced3615f31c273a3efbef1cccc0b3cc4fb383119e260cc545bb665d0:2

value
155646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93dcdfb248238d6a428fdd7419aa94fdd69bf2f0 OP_EQUAL
address
3FAqrKmnPbgRENafQTnYBbWWqvmEx8RtdQ
transaction
d5ca880bced3615f31c273a3efbef1cccc0b3cc4fb383119e260cc545bb665d0
spent
true